Exploring Geothermal Parks
Rotorua boasts several world-renowned geothermal parks, each offering a distinct experience.
- Te Puia: Witness the Pohutu geyser, one of the largest active geysers in the Southern Hemisphere, alongside bubbling mud pools and stunning geothermal formations. Te Puia also offers captivating Māori cultural performances, including the powerful haka. This is a must-see for any Rotorua geothermal parks tour.
- Wai-O-Tapu: Explore a kaleidoscope of vibrant colours in this geothermal wonderland. See the Champagne Pool, its shimmering waters a testament to Rotorua's geothermal activity, and the Lady Knox Geyser, which erupts daily. Wai-O-Tapu offers a variety of guided tours catering to different interests.
- Hell's Gate: Experience the raw power of nature at Hell's Gate, where you can witness powerful geysers and mud pools up close. Take a mud bath for a truly unique geothermal experience. This Rotorua geothermal park offers a more rugged, adventurous experience.
These Rotorua geothermal parks offer incredible opportunities to witness the geothermal activity firsthand. Many offer guided tours providing valuable insights into the geology and cultural significance of these areas.
Relaxing in Geothermal Spas
Beyond the geothermal parks, Rotorua offers a range of geothermal spas and hot pools perfect for relaxation and rejuvenation.
- Polynesian Spa: This iconic spa features a variety of private and public pools, each drawing from different geothermal springs with unique mineral compositions. Enjoy breathtaking views while soaking in the therapeutic waters.
- DeBretts Hot Springs: Offers a range of hot pools, from private spa pools to family pools, with stunning views of the surrounding landscape.
- Princes Gate Spa: This luxurious spa provides a tranquil escape, combining geothermal bathing with a range of spa treatments.
The health benefits of geothermal bathing are well-documented, offering relief from muscle aches, stress, and other ailments. Rotorua's geothermal spas provide the perfect opportunity to unwind and recharge.
Unique Geothermal Experiences
Beyond the well-known parks and spas, Rotorua offers some less-visited, yet equally rewarding, geothermal experiences.
- Kuirau Park: This free public park features several naturally occurring hot pools and mud pools, offering a budget-friendly way to experience Rotorua's geothermal activity.
- Tikitere Hot Springs: These springs offer a more intimate and less crowded geothermal experience compared to the larger parks.
These unique Rotorua experiences offer a chance to discover the city's geothermal wonders beyond the typical tourist trail.
Immersive Māori Culture in Rotorua
Rotorua is deeply rooted in Māori culture, offering visitors an unparalleled opportunity to immerse themselves in the traditions and history of the indigenous people of New Zealand.
Traditional Māori Performances
Witnessing a traditional Māori performance is a highlight of any visit to Rotorua.
- Te Puia: Experience captivating performances including the powerful haka and moving storytelling.
- Tamaki Māori Village: Enjoy an immersive evening with a traditional feast, captivating storytelling, and a breathtaking haka performance.
These performances showcase the rich cultural heritage of the Māori people, offering a powerful and unforgettable experience. The authenticity and passion of the performers make these Rotorua Māori experiences truly special.
Exploring Māori Villages
Visiting a traditional Māori village offers a unique glimpse into Māori life.
- Whakarewarewa Living Māori Village: Explore this authentic village and witness traditional crafts like carving and weaving. Learn about their daily life and customs.
- Ohinemutu Village: Situated on the shores of Lake Rotorua, this village showcases the strong connection between the Māori people and the environment.
These Rotorua Māori villages offer an intimate and enriching experience, allowing visitors to connect with the local community and learn about their culture firsthand.
Learning about Māori History
Rotorua provides various opportunities to delve into the rich history of the Māori people.
- Rotorua Museum: Explore exhibits showcasing Māori artifacts, art, and history.
- Guided tours: Consider a guided tour focusing on Māori history, offering deeper insights into the region’s past.
Understanding Māori history enriches the experience of visiting Rotorua, providing context and appreciation for the cultural significance of the region.
Adventure Activities in Rotorua
Beyond its cultural and geothermal attractions, Rotorua is a haven for adventure seekers.
Outdoor Adventures
Rotorua offers a range of thrilling outdoor activities.
- Mountain biking: Explore the world-class mountain biking trails in the Whakarewarewa Forest.
- Hiking: Enjoy scenic walks and hikes through native forests and along the shores of Lake Rotorua.
- Zorbing: Experience the unique thrill of rolling downhill inside a giant transparent ball.
These Rotorua activities cater to different fitness levels and provide breathtaking views of the surrounding landscape.
Water Sports
Rotorua's lakes and rivers offer various water-based activities.
- Kayaking: Paddle across the calm waters of Lake Rotorua, enjoying the stunning scenery.
- White-water rafting: For a more adventurous experience, try white-water rafting on the Kaituna River.
These Rotorua water activities provide a different perspective of the region's natural beauty.
